SIM800 restart every 10 seconds

Hello,

I have SIM800 and arduino mega. I connected SIM800 to 5V and to GND from Arduino, I didn't upload any code yet, but SIM800 restarts every 10 seconds ( there are two leds on SIM800, one is blinking every 1 sec and the other one restart every 10 seconds which is the power of the SIM as I figured out recently.

I tried to change the wires type, and I tried to supply the SIM800 with an external 9V supply by using L7805.

P.S. : I don't use any capacitor, does it has any effect on this issue ?

Check the specs on your SIM800. They board I have requires 6-24V for input and does it's own voltage regulation. Connecting it to 5V from the Arduino won't work.

I don't think the voltage is the problem, and before 2 months I tried to use 9V battery and connect it directly to the SIM800 and it burns out. Also, I check the datasheet from google, It says the input should be 3.4 - 4.4V